Head of State: In Venezuela there is a transition to Bolivarian socialism

President Nicolás Maduro assured that in Venezuela the construction of a society with the principles of equality, peace and solidarity “takes time, but we have advanced thanks to the ideology of Commander Chávez.

“We have an important vanguard in the People, in ordinary men, in ordinary women. Chávez spoke a lot about socialism in the territorial sphere, I think it is the great contribution in the theory of world socialism, to economic socialism,” said the President in the program “With Maduro +” No. 45.

In addition, during the “Digital Zone” segment, he emphasized that thanks to the conscience and values of Venezuelan society, it has been possible to build a state of social welfare with organization, a clear and humane vision.

He added that in Venezuela “there is a transition to socialism, a socialism with Bolivarian, Christian and profoundly democratic values.”

In conversation with the influencer, Diego Ruzzarín, about the new socio-economic formation with a socialist orientation that is developing in progressive countries, which seek to consolidate the foundations of equality and social justice.

In the same way, he stressed that the Venezuelan people, under the worst circumstances faced with the imposition of unilateral coercive measures, “set out to build a new economic model, which has made it possible to face the criminal blockade.”

“We are building a new social economic formation (...) that is the material base of society, the economy is in the process of reconstruction, because it's not just about building, but we have also faced the blockade,” he stressed.
